live recording off mixerboard to cassette.

from an era before the internet.

originally broadcast friday nights across niagara region on b-rock radio 103.7 midnight - 4am

live show using the entire vinyl library of a small town community radio station + whatever dollar bin records i found that week in st.catharines or toronto.

2 turntables & mixer, often with random record selection.
occasional samples from vcr.

no beat counters, mp3s, traktor, ableton, fx, pedals or slaptops involved. final scratch wasn't invented yet.

funkspiel means 'radio games' in german. it aired weekly for the better part of a year and only ever had 2 callers. one said 'stop messing with me', the other 'just wow, man'.

these mixtapes were recorded haphazardly, and the first & last show weren't recorded.

the actual first episode was a 2 hour lecture on the history of radio, that was waay deeper than marconi as i was doing a research degree at the time. india.

the show ended it's run with a giant audio experiment of a house party streaming to an answering machine.
3 bands played in different rooms and party-goers would pick the phones up or down on different floors of the house to remix the audio.

have some photos of that, but never found the audio.

in the 90's indie radio used to be almost the only way you heard about music that wasn't top 40 schlock. no napster, myspace, soundcloud, etc.

mixtapes from your friends was the other.

this show was originally conceived as a kind of public consciousness shared mixtape of the soundtrack of everyone's friday night, played simultaneously.
& then the dreams of people as they fell asleep after being out galavanting.
